?️ What is GeoWoodstock?
The first GeoWoodstock event was created by JoGPS, a geocacher from Tennessee, in 2003 to bring cachers from across the United States together. By 2006, it had become popular internationally and GeoWoodstock 4 was the first-ever geocaching event to attain Mega-event status. GeoWoodstock 2018 was the first Giga event held outside of Europe. Continuing the long line of history, GeoWoodstock is excited to visit West Virginia to celebrate 25 years of Geocaching.
